About the foundation

The aim of the Make it a Life Foundation is to support destitute, single mothers and their children in Africa by helping them to help themselves.

Children group photo make it a life foundation

What is “Make it a Life Foundation”?

The foundation is currently active in Akim Oda, a town in the Eastern Region on the Birim River in the West African state of Ghana.

As everywhere in the world, women and girls are the worst affected by poverty. That is why we support destitute, single women and make sure that girls do not take a back seat to boys in any way in our program.

Initial situation

In Akim Oda, as everywhere in Africa and the world, there are many single mothers who are left alone by the fathers of their children and who are destitute and can barely earn a living for their children, or only under the most difficult conditions. They often have to leave their children unattended all day in order to work. The children of these mothers, who in many cases are left to fend for themselves without help, often live in conditions in which the children are usually not guaranteed regular meals, little caring attention and insufficient clothing.

Children do not go to school or the results of their school education are often characterized by major deficits. Although school attendance is compulsory, enforcement and implementation are often inadequate. It is common for children to end their schooling illiterate.

The lack of basic skills in reading, writing and life planning leads to continued poverty and lack of opportunities and often ultimately to migration and emigration.

The foundation – Make it a Life Foundation Ghana – ensures that the children in its care are taught essential basic skills that enable them to shape their own lives and not succumb to the consequences of poverty and lack of opportunities. We want to contribute to giving destitute, single mothers and their children the tools for a future that excludes poverty, dependency and emigration.

What we do!

The foundation – Make it a Life foundation Ghana – supports destitute, single women by ensuring that their children go to school and are fed, so that their mothers can go to work without worrying because they know that their children are being looked after. At their own request, the mothers receive start-up assistance from us in the form of small financial amounts if they wish to become self-employed and pursue an independent activity (service, small trade, home-grown crops, etc.). In this way, the women are enabled to achieve a significant and sustainable improvement in their lives.

How we achieve these goals?

The NGO – Make it a Life Foundation, Ghana – runs a facility in Akim Oda, Ghana, where children and their mothers can eat, are looked after and taught basic skills. Kitchen, toilets, training rooms are available.

Mothers and children for whom the journey to this facility is too far are looked after in our partner schools, which are located nearby. Our partner schools are public schools that provide us with suitable premises. The foundation – Make it a Life Foundation, Ghana – provides volunteer teaching staff and volunteer supervisors who implement our line on site in accordance with our charter. It is ensured that the children can eat at their school in the mornings.

We also provide them with a warm lunch after school.

How does the foundation help?

  • The children receive extra tuition and additional lessons to accompany their schooling
  • The children receive warm meals
  • The association covers the costs of teaching materials and school supplies
  • The children receive clothing if required
  • The mothers receive a small start-up aid to help themselves
  • They receive advice and support in planning their lives

What is our concept?

We provide the children with extended practical knowledge to accompany and support their normal school education. This helps them to stabilize their everyday lives.

It also teaches them relevant skills for their future. To this end, the children take part in our after-school program at the facility of – Make it a Life Foundation – in Akim Oda, Ghana, as well as at our partner schools.

Our program teaches the children in a playful way to understand practical relationships, to strive for solutions in a group or individually, to shape their own lives and not to succumb to the consequences of a lack of education, poverty and lack of opportunities.

This is what we offer the children:

  • Homework help
  • Supplementary lessons in writing and arithmetic
  • Language and writing games
  • Cultivation of plants
  • Working with natural materials
  • Handicrafts
  • Practical knowledge (simple, manual skills)
  • Passing on traditions and making music
  • Ecological methods for household and cultivation
  • Dealing with money

We are constantly working on expanding the range!

The children and their mothers are supported in the sense of helping them to help themselves in order to achieve a sustainable stabilization of their living conditions. We support the mothers in planning their lives. Our aim is to stabilize the children’s lives and give them the tools for a future that prevents poverty, dependency and emigration.

We take country-specific, traditional circumstances into account in our programs. We teach the basics of hygiene and an ecological approach to the environment.

Sustainable concepts such as the economical use of water and energy, but also, for example, the use of solar stoves and home composting of waste are taken into account.
